Overview

This is an onsite position in Raleigh, NC.

This position is responsible for providing technical leadership and operational support for the Infrastructure & Associate Technology Asset Management function. Provides expert guidance and mentorship on system technical support, maintenance, and enhancement. Leads the administration of software and hardware that supports customer sales and service applications. Installs, automates, and tests infrastructures for continuous improvement. Monitors overall systems performance to identify potential issues and tune appropriately. Addresses failed components or technical issues and provides resolution. Oversees the work of less experienced associates and serves as a technical resource to wider business unit.

Responsibilities

  • Review hardware requests and perform needs assessments to determine if requests meet FCB hardware standards.
  • Evaluate hardware purchasing requirements through reporting and analysis of inventory data.
  • Perform hands on hardware system configuration, hardware deployment and maintenance, hardware life-cycle management.
  • Ensure hardware requests are reviewed and assigned in a within established service levels and ensure adequate hardware is available for normal and DR business requirements.
  • Assist associates with ordering process and work with Depot & Asset Control, Hardware Asset Management and ITSM teams to report issues with and to enhance/develop systems/workflows for associate requests.
  • Coordinate activities related to asset management, including box pickup requests, termination reclamation, and assist with general equipment requests.
  • Work with IT Service Management, Hardware Asset Management, Depot & Asset Control and other infrastructure teams on process improvement related to the Operational Asset Management functions.
  • Apply current asset controls industry standards for hardware assets.
